The Bigger Picture
Scotland's preparation for the FIFA World Cup 2026 is marked by a notable cultural shift, as evidenced by the team's lighthearted approach, including 'cartwheels at breakfast.' This change reflects a newfound confidence and unity within the squad, crucial as they aim to make an impact in the tournament. With a well-drilled aggressive pressing system, Scotland's 3-5-2 formation is designed to maximize their strengths, particularly through the quality of their wing-backs and the team's overall spirit. This tactical evolution under manager Steve Clarke positions them as a competitive force in Group C, where they will face challenges that could exploit their vulnerabilities.
The significance of this cultural shift cannot be understated; it not only enhances team morale but also sets a tone for their competitive mindset. The combination of tactical discipline and a positive environment is essential as they prepare to take on their opponents, starting with their opening match against Haiti on June 14, 2026.

Historical Context
Scotland's World Cup history reveals a narrative of struggle, with no titles and only eight appearances in the tournament. Their all-time record of four wins, seven draws, and twelve losses highlights the challenges they have faced on the global stage. This historical context adds weight to their current campaign, as the team seeks to break free from past disappointments and establish a new legacy.
The pressure to perform is palpable, especially considering their previous lack of success in high-stakes matches. This World Cup presents an opportunity for Scotland to redefine their narrative and demonstrate that they can compete with the best, making their cultural and tactical shifts even more significant.
